예제 #1
0
                 Display::display_normal_message($message);
                 break;
         }
         Security::clear_token();
     }
 }
 if (isset($_POST['action'])) {
     $check = Security::check_token('get');
     if ($check) {
         switch ($_POST['action']) {
             case 'delete':
                 if (api_is_platform_admin()) {
                     $number_of_selected_groups = count($_POST['id']);
                     $number_of_deleted_groups = 0;
                     foreach ($_POST['id'] as $index => $group_id) {
                         if (GroupPortalManager::delete($group_id)) {
                             $number_of_deleted_groups++;
                         }
                     }
                 }
                 if ($number_of_selected_groups == $number_of_deleted_groups) {
                     Display::display_confirmation_message(get_lang('SelectedGroupsDeleted'));
                 } else {
                     Display::display_error_message(get_lang('SomeGroupsNotDeleted'));
                 }
                 break;
         }
         Security::clear_token();
     }
 }
 // Create a search-box